One more Q : any good food joints around the city centre? along Jalan Gaya or elsewhere?

I'm just keeping to the city because it's only a short break. Thanks again!
*
Jalan Gaya.
1.kedai kopi yee fung . Try laksa and chicken rice..Pls go early as many ppl will queue.

2. Kedai kopi yuit Cheong. Try roti kahwin (actually is our butter and kaya) . I don't have chance try their pork satay (if Ur not Muslim). as satay start 11am...There is Malay stall selling also the bakso and mee rebus very nice.

3. Welcome seafood

Other place...
4.Kedai kopi New mui vui. Try dumpling. Nice.. I dun have stomach eat their ikan Bakar Liao after I finish welcome seafood .

My fren told me yu yee bak kut teh (at gaya also) also nice.. me not enough time to try it.
